Study of Transport Properties in Armchair Graphyne Nanoribbons: A Density Functional Approach

Description

In present paper, the non-equilibrium Green function (NEGF) method along with the density functional theory (DFT) are used to investigate the effect of width on transport and electronic properties of armchair graphyne (γ-graphyne) nanoribbons. The results show that all the studied nanoribbons are semiconductor and their band gaps decrease as the widths of nanoribbons increase, which will result in increasing current at a certain voltage. Also our results show the promising application of armchair graphyne nanoribbons in nano-electrical devices. (paper)
